HYPERFINE INTERACTIONS IN (Cr0.9957Fe0.01)3+xSi1-x

X-ray diffraction measurements and Mössbauer spectroscopy with external magnetic field were carried out on (Cr0.9957Fe0.01)3+xSi1–x alloys. The Mössbauer spectra for A15 type of structure can be described by superposition of single line S(1) and two doublets D(1) and D(2). The relative ratio of the S(1) and D(2) strongly depends on x. The nearest neighbours of these components have been identified. It was shown that 57Fe atoms preferentially locate in Cr positions for x =< 0.0, while for x > 0.0 iron atoms are distributed both in Cr and Si positions. It was shown that, in A15 structure, one Cr atom located in the 57Fe nearest neighbours (n.n.) decreases isomer shift by (0.022 ± 0.002) mm/s, while one Si in n.n. increases isomer shift by (0.09 +/- 0.01) mm/s. The measured Mössbauer spectra of bcc Cr-Si indicate that atoms are randomly distributed and can be well described as superposition of single lines, related to various local environments of 57Fe atoms.
